git密码怎么看
-
要查看你在git中保存的密码,可以按照以下步骤进行操作:
1. 打开终端或命令提示符,进入你的git项目的根目录。
2. 输入以下命令:
“`
git config –global credential.helper
“`
该命令会显示当前配置的凭据助手(credential helper)。3. 如果凭据助手为`manager`,可以输入以下命令查看保存的密码:
“`
git credential-manager get
“`
如果凭据助手为其他类型,可以根据具体助手的命令行指令查看保存的密码。可以查阅凭据助手的官方文档或手册来获取更多信息。4. 当你输入上述命令后,可能会提示你输入你的git用户名和密码。输入正确的信息后,保存的密码应该会显示在终端或命令提示符中。
请注意,根据你使用的操作系统和git的版本,具体的命令和步骤可能会有所不同。可以参考git的官方文档或在网上搜索相关内容,以获取更准确的信息。
2年前 -
回答:
1. Git密码是加密存储在用户计算机或Git服务器上的,不应该以明文形式显示。因此,无法直接查看Git密码。
2. Git使用SSH或HTTPS协议进行远程仓库的访问和身份验证。不同的协议有不同的身份验证方式。
3. 如果使用SSH协议,Git使用公钥和私钥进行身份验证。私钥储存在用户的计算机上,通常位于用户的家目录的.ssh文件夹中。但是,私钥本身是加密的,不能直接查看其中的密码。
4. 如果使用HTTPS协议,Git使用用户名和密码进行身份验证。在Git首次连接远程仓库时,通常会提示用户输入用户名和密码,并提供选项来记住密码。密码会以加密形式存储在用户的计算机上,不可直接查看。但是,一些Git客户端提供了查看或重置保存的密码选项。
5. 如果您忘记了Git密码,可以通过重置密码或重新生成SSH密钥对的方式来解决。具体操作取决于您使用的Git服务提供商和客户端工具。
总之,为了保护您的Git密码安全,建议采取以下措施:
– 使用强密码。
– 定期更改密码。
– 不要将密码明文存储在任何位置。
– 使用安全的密钥对进行SSH身份验证。
– 不要在公共计算机上保存密码。2年前 -
如果你想查看存储在Git中的密码,那么我必须先提醒你,Git并不存储密码。Git是一个分布式版本控制系统,它只负责管理代码的版本历史记录,并不存储个人密码。当你使用Git时,你可能需要输入密码来进行身份验证,但是密码一般是存储在远程仓库或者其他版本控制系统中的。
如果你忘记了Git的密码,或者想要更改密码,你需要通过以下步骤来完成。
## 1. 远程库账户密码
如果你使用的是远程仓库,例如GitHub、GitLab或Bitbucket等,你需要去相应的网站找回或更改密码。
通常情况下,这些网站会提供一个“忘记密码”的选项。你可以点击该选项,然后按照提示进行操作,以找回你的密码或者创建一个新的密码。
## 2. 本地Git凭据
如果你在使用Git时,配置了Git凭据记住密码的功能,那么Git会将你的凭据保存在本地。在某些情况下,你可能需要查看或删除这些凭据。
### 2.1 查看凭据
在命令行中,你可以使用以下命令来查看你的Git凭据:
“`
git config –global credential.helper
“`这个命令会显示你当前使用的凭据帮助程序。
### 2.2 删除凭据
如果你想删除凭据,你可以使用以下命令来清除保存在本地的Git凭据:
“`
git credential-manager delete –host=github.com
“`你需要将 `–host` 参数的值替换为你使用的Git主机。通过运行以上命令,会删除与指定主机相关的所有凭据。
## 3. 重新配置Git凭据
如果你更改了Git凭据或者重新安装了Git,并且想要存储新的凭据,你可以使用以下命令重新配置Git凭据:
“`
git config –global credential.helper store
“`这将会把凭据存储在明文文件中。Git会将这些凭据保存在你的用户主目录下的`.git-credentials`文件中。
注意:明文存储密码在安全性上是有风险的,请谨慎使用此方法。另外,你也可以考虑使用其他凭据管理器来保护你的密码。
总结起来,如果你想查看存储在Git中的密码,首先要知道Git并不存储密码。如果你想要找回或更改远程库账户密码,你需要去相应的网站处理。如果你想查看或删除本地Git凭据,你可以使用命令行来操作。重新配置Git凭据可以通过命令行重新设置。
2年前